10 Tips and Tricks for Choosing the Best Conference Apps

It’s truly a hustle to choose the right conference app that can greatly improve your event planning and attendee experience. With so many options available, it's important to know what to look for. If you’re confused, too, here are ten tips and tricks to help you choose from the top conference apps.

1. Identify Your Needs

Before you start looking at apps, identify what you need. Are you seeking features such as registration, networking tools, or live polling? Identifying your requirements will assist you in narrowing down your choices.

2. User-Friendly Interface

Choose an app with an intuitive and user-friendly interface. Both event planners and attendees should find it easy to navigate and use. This makes the experience smoother and more enjoyable for everyone.

3. Customization Options

Look for apps that offer customization options. This allows you to tailor the app to match your event’s branding and specific needs, making it more relevant to your attendees.

4. Integration with Other Tools

Make sure the app integrates well with other tools you are using. This could include email marketing platforms, social media, and other event management software. Integration can save you time and streamline your processes.

5. Real-Time Updates

Choose an app that supports real-time updates. This is useful for sending out last-minute changes or important announcements during the event. Attendees can stay informed and engaged throughout the conference.

6. Networking Features

Networking is a key aspect of any conference. Look for apps with features that facilitate networking, such as attendee directories, messaging, and meeting scheduling. This can enhance the overall experience for your attendees.

7. Analytics and Reporting

An app with strong analytics and reporting capabilities can be very helpful. It allows you to track attendee engagement, session popularity, and overall event performance. This data is valuable for improving future events.

8. Customer Support

Good customer support is crucial. Choose an app from a provider that offers reliable customer support. This can help you resolve any issues quickly and ensure your event runs smoothly.

9. Budget-Friendly

While looking for best conference app, it's important to consider your budget. Compare the pricing and features of different apps to find one that offers good value for money without compromising on essential features.

10. Read Reviews and Get Recommendations

Finally, read reviews and get recommendations from other event planners. This can provide insights into the app’s performance and reliability. Personal recommendations can often point you toward the best options.
